Mexican Popsicles (Paletas)

Refreshing, colorful popsicles made with real fruit, lime, and natural ingredients. These paletas are easy to make at home and perfect for a summer treat, offering both water-based (paletas de agua) and cream-based (paletas de crema) varieties.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Freeze Time 6 hours
Total Time 6 hours 15 minutes
Course Dessert, Snack
Cuisine Mexican
Calories 120 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 3 cups of fresh fruit strawberries, mango, watermelon, pineapple – your choice!
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ar adjust to taste
  • 1/3 cup water
  • 3 tablespoons freshly squeezed lime juice

Instructions
 

  • Blend Half the Fruit: In a blender, combine half the fruit, sugar, water, and lime juice. Blend until smooth.

  • Add Fruit Chunks: Spoon the remaining chopped fruit into popsicle molds.

  • Pour and Freeze: Pour the blended mixture into the molds, leaving about 1/2 inch of space for expansion.

  • Insert Sticks: If your molds don’t have built-in sticks, freeze for an hour, then insert wooden popsicle sticks.
  • Freeze Fully: Let them freeze for at least 6 hours or overnight.
  • Enjoy: Run the molds under warm water for a few seconds to easily release your Mexican popsicles.

Notes

  • Sugar Adjustment: Taste your fruit first and adjust the sugar accordingly.
  • Add-Ins: Experiment with herbs (like mint) or spices (like chili powder) for a unique twist.
  • Mold Tip: Use silicone molds for easier release.
